Pecking
//ˈpɛkɪŋ// noun, verb
noun, verb ·Uncommon 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 The act by which something is pecked. countable, uncountable
"the peckings of hungry chickens"
- 2 The ancient skill of shaping stone into tools, containers, or artworks. countable, uncountable
- 3 The game of throwing pebbles at birds. countable, obsolete, uncountable
Verb
- 1 present participle and gerund of peck form-of, gerund, participle, present
